Q

What is deforestation?

A

Deforestation is the process whereby natural forests are cleared through logging and/or burning, either to use the timber or to replace the area for alternative uses.

Q

What is lithosphere?

A

the rigid outer part of the earth, consisting of the crust and upper mantle.

16
Q

What is biosphere?

A

the regions of the surface and atmosphere of the earth or another planet occupied by living organisms.

17
Q

What is hydrosphere?

A

all the waters on the earth’s surface, such as lakes and seas, and sometimes including water over the earth’s surface, such as clouds.

18
Q

What is atmosphere?

A

the envelope of gases surrounding the earth or another planet.
